How they compare
Kuwait currently reports 11.77 years against 10.69 years in SDG: Southern Asia, a difference of 1.08 years.
That makes Kuwait's figure about 1.1 times SDG: Southern Asia's.
Across all 16 years both countries report, Kuwait has been ahead every year.
Kuwait ranks 98th and SDG: Southern Asia ranks 96th of 213 countries.
Kuwait has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Kuwait | SDG: Southern Asia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 10.39 years | 7.68 years | 2.71 years | Kuwait |
| 2000s | 11.96 years | 8.52 years | 3.45 years | Kuwait |
| 2010s | 11.8 years | 9.7 years | 2.1 years | Kuwait |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
